Dolly Parton’s Legacy Is Expanding!

Dolly Parton’s highly anticipated SongTeller Hotel and Dolly’s Life of Many Colors Museum will soon be opening their doors in downtown Nashville!

The highly anticipated hotel in downtown Nashville has been in the works for more than two years. Dolly first announced plans for the hotel on June 6, 2024, during CMA Fest.

The project, developed by The Dollywood Company, is located at 211 Commerce Street and is designed to celebrate Dolly’s life, music and legacy.

According to Dolly’s website, the hotel is the country music legend’s “love letter to Nashville, featuring 245 unique guest rooms and suites, two live entertainment venues, café and vibrant spaces designed to celebrate Dolly’s career and the spirit of Music City.”

The hotel’s entertainment offerings will include two distinctive live music venues, Jolene’s and Parton’s Live, giving guests multiple ways to experience the heart of Music City.

Now, less than a month after the superstar’s death, another feature of the hotel is poised to be especially meaningful for fans. Adding an incredibly personal element to the SongTeller Hotel experience is Dolly’s Life of Many Colors Museum, which will span the hotel’s entire third floor. 

The immersive museum will take guests on a journey through Dolly’s extraordinary legacy, combining personal stories with rarely seen items from her own collection.

Interactive exhibits and curated experiences will give visitors an intimate look at the people, places and moments that helped shape the country music icon’s remarkable career.

On September 14, the SongTeller Hotel will begin welcoming guests and bringing its live entertainment spaces to life with a lineup that includes rising artists and special appearances from members of the Parton family.

Dolly’s cousin, Richie Owens, will perform at Parton’s Live on September 16, while her niece, Jada Star, will kick off her twice-weekly artist residency on September 17 and 19.

Beginning Tuesday, September 29, fans can purchase tickets to experience Dolly’s Life of Many Colors Museum.
